Control unit and buzzer
Position the control unit in the luggage compartment, in a dry place, away from water infiltrations.
Mount the buzzer with the supplied double-faced adhesive tape or screws where the driver will clearly hear the audible signals.
Find a factory grommet in the rear of the vehicle. Feed the sensor wires through the grommet and route them outside of the vehicle.

Sensors
The parking sensors can be fitted either from the inside of the bumper (Fig. A) or from the outside (Fig. B) with the specific snap-in adapters.
a)
Installation on the inside of the bumper:
1.
Clean and degrease around the fitting holes.
2.
Choose the suitable type of adapters according to the bumper shape:
Standard (Ø 18mm hole)
Angled 10° (Ø 20mm hole) to correct the angle of the sensor heads on bumpers that curve up or down.
3.
Peel off the adhesive film on one side of the adapter pad and apply on the front side of the adapter as illustrated below.
4.
Peel off the remaining adhesive liner and align the adapters on the 4 holes previously drilled in the bumper.
5.
Clip the sensors into the adapters with the arrows and the UP indication facing upwards.
